I took Adriamycin with Cytoxin in 4 dose dense(2 week) sessions starting March 6, 2006. I had severe nausea, so I was taking 6 different nausea meds to control it, but they worked. I had some stomach lining damage from the Adriamycin (found during an endoscopy following chemo)but a few months of Nexium fixed it. Otherwise, I had the standard side effects of yeast and ulcers, full hair loss, fatigue, etc. Let me know if there is anything else you'd like to know.

I had it with Cytoxan for four rounds also. I did well with the nausea with meds and diet change. I lost my hair completely, including eyelashes and eyebrows. I got permanent heart damage from the Adriamycin and Herceptin I took. That is a side effect to be aware of. Generally, you feel pretty lousy, but there's lots you can still do. I had a 4 year old, 2 year old and 8 month old and I was up every night with the baby, bringing them to the ER in the middle of the night, doing laundry and housework. Hope this helps
